Résumé : |
This article is a dive into the daily lives of several managers. It shows a reality very different from the practices and behaviors mentioned in the light of all. Exploring, searching and discovering a universe sometimes dark and amazing, we returned to the secret garden of deviance. The exemplarity is sought over the interviews and often takes a very dissonant coloring. It gives way to the deviance at the heart of the situations that the managers interviewed echoed. Another alternative is emerging in the daily work situations. Negative or positive, deviance takes many forms and refers organizational behavior to simple forms of expression: gaining an advantage, preserving or protecting an asset, limiting the presence of power, taking advantage of opportunities, and so on. |
